Klingman & Associates LLC Purchases New Stake in CorVel Corp. $CRVL

Klingman & Associates LLC purchased a new stake in CorVel Corp. (NASDAQ:CRVLF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or purchased 2,793 shares of the business services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$287,000.

CorVel Stock Up 3.4%

CRVL stock opened at $76.37 on Wednesday. CorVel Corp. has a fifty-two week low of $70.47 and a fifty-two week high of $128.61. The firm’s 50-day simple moving average is $81.87 and its 200 day simple moving average is $96.77. The stock has a market cap of $3.92 billion, a PE ratio of 39.37 and a beta of 0.95.

CorVel (NASDAQ:CRVLG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 5th. The business services provider reported $0.52 earnings per share for the quarter. CorVel had a net margin of 10.98% and a return on equity of 32.31%. The business had revenue of $234.71 million for the quarter.

CorVel Profile

(Free Report)

CorVel Corporation provides workers’ compensation, auto, liability, and health solutions. It applies technology, including artificial intelligence, machine learning, and natural language processing to enhance the managing of episodes of care and the related health care costs. The company also offers network solutions services, including automated medical fee auditing, preferred provider management and reimbursement, retrospective utilization review, facility claim review, professional review, pharmacy, directed care, clearinghouse, independent medical examination, and inpatient medical bill review services, as well as Medicare solutions.
